概述

This course focuses on the study of semiconductor materials and processing technologies specifically applied in the field of energy. Students will gain comprehensive knowledge about the diverse applications of semiconductor materials, extending beyond electronic devices to encompass energy storage devices and solar cells. Notably, silicon material will be explored extensively due to its crucial role in lithium-ion batteries and photovoltaic cells. Moreover, students will learn about semiconductor processing techniques that enable the production of precise and controlled structures, vital for manufacturing thin-film lithium batteries, 3D batteries, and thin-film solar cells. The course is designed to cater to young semiconductor talents who possess a keen interest in the application of semiconductor technologies in energy storage devices such as electric vehicles and energy storage stations, as well as solar cells.

週次計畫
週次主題
第 1 週

Introduction to Semiconductor – Warmup

2024-09-03(二)
第 2 週

Introduction to Li-ion Battery (I):History and Theory

2024-09-10(二)
第 3 週

Introduction to Li-ion Battery (II): Component Materials

2024-09-17(二)
第 4 週

Introduction to Li-ion Battery (III):Design and Manufacturing

2024-09-24(二)
第 5 週

Introduction to Li-ion Battery (IV):Electric Vehicle Batteries

2024-10-01(二)
第 6 週

Anode Materials for Li-ion Battery

2024-10-08(二)
第 7 週

Silicon Anode Materials for Li-ion Battery – Mechanisms and Challenges/Structural Design

2024-10-15(二)
第 8 週

Mid-term Exam

2024-10-22(二)
第 9 週

Other Semiconductor Anode Materials for Li-ion Battery

2024-10-29(二)
第 10 週

Semiconductor Processing – Thin Film Lithium Battery Design

2024-11-05(二)
第 11 週

Semiconductor Processing – 3D Battery Design

2024-11-12(二)
第 12 週

Introduction to Hydrogen Energy

2024-11-19(二)
第 13 週

Introduction to Solar Cell (I):History and Theory

2024-11-26(二)
第 14 週

Introduction to Solar Cell (II):Materials and Manufacturing

2024-12-03(二)
第 15 週

Semiconductor Processing – Solar Cell Design

2024-12-10(二)
第 16 週

Final Exam

2024-12-17(二)
